Path: utzoo!utgpu!jarvis.csri.toronto.edu!mailrus!csd4.milw.wisc.edu!bbn!mit-eddie!uw-beaver!rice!sun-spots-request From: sunuk!sungy!berthold!joerg@sun.com (Joerg Schilling) Newsgroups: comp.sys.sun Subject: Re: sticky bit Message-ID: <8902201647.AA02919@MINNI.> Date: 2 Mar 89 07:50:41 GMT Sender: usenet@rice.edu Organization: Sun-Spots Lines: 24 Approved: Sun-Spots@rice.edu Original-Date: Mon, 20 Feb 89 17:47:54 +0100 X-Sun-Spots-Digest: Volume 7, Issue 178, message 4 of 13 The sticky bit has been redefined for Sun OS 4.0 : It now means not to cache write blocks and is used for NFS swap partitions to prevent blowing up the page cash on a server. Do not use it on executable files. (The only file on a 3.x Release with the sticky bit turned on was vi which now has 755) The manual pages are *wrong* in case of executable files !!!! For directories have a look at the manual page: man 8 sticky. J. Schilling H.
